Grub prevention and control are important for protecting lawns from the damage triggered by beetle larvae feeding upon grassroots. Early detection is key-- signs consist of brown patches that raise easily from the soil or an increase in birds and other wildlife digging for grubs. Preventive treatments, applied at the correct time in the grub life process, can significantly decrease problems These treatments may be chemical or biological, such as useful nematodes that naturally decrease grub populations. For active invasions, alleviative products can be used, though they are most reliable when grubs are small and actively feeding. A proactive approach, including correct lawn maintenance, aeration, and overseeding, helps reduce the possibility of severe grub problems. Healthy lawns recuperate quicker from damage and are less susceptible to recurring invasions.
